Situated within a small shopping centre, we had seen this restaurant many times, but never visited. We went in early on a Sunday evening thinking we would try some take away, but in a whim decided to eat in, the decor is very basic but clean, and the welcome genuinely friendly. Upon being seated, we were immediately offered menus, given a complimentary basket of prawn crackers and glasses and a bottle of water. Asked if we would like our wine glasses removed, I decided to pop to the nearby bottle shop for a wine. (No corkage charged). We started with mini dim sims and vegetarian spring rolls, both beautifully cooked. I chose Garlic Prawns, and my husband Mongolian Lamb, and steamed rice to share. All dishes on the menu are rated with "chillies" for heat, which is helpful, as well as indicating vegetarian and gluten free dishes. Both mains were delicious, and there were 10 prawns in my serve, which I consider generous. All up only $48, great value. They are open Tuesday to Sunday 5pm - 9pm, and also offer delivery to nearby areas for only $5. They were doing a steady trade in takeaways when we were there. Can't wait to try some more, although I might opt for takeaway, as the automatic air freshener spray was a bit strong for me.
